Transpennine Amey is working in partnership with Network Rail on the Transpennine route upgrade project since 2018, with an increased focus on providing reliable, frequent, faster, and greener railways to the North of England. Covering 76 miles of railway between Manchester, Leeds, York, Selby and onto Humberside, we lay the foundations, covering upgrades to civils, track, railway systems and electrification to the west of Leeds. By completing such works, we aim to support Network Rail with cutting carbon emissions and ensuring to deliver a smoother, more enjoyable journey to their customers.

Construction Manager plays an important part in assisting the Project Manager / or Works Manager in delivering allocated contract safely in accordance with legislation and Amey procedures to contract specification and programme, while effectively supervising and delivering the approved construction programmes to the agreed resource and cost plans. 

The standard hours of work are 37.5 hrs per week.

You will be responsible for:

  • Responsible for planning the project activities. This includes defining methodology for complete execution, considering timelines, resources, and deliverables. Develop a detailed schedule, outlining when each task should occur. This ensures that the project progresses smoothly and stays on track.
  • Responsible for identifying and managing potential risks that could affect project execution. Construction managers conduct risk assessments, develop mitigation strategies, and ensure compliance with safety regulations and building codes. Prioritizing safety on-site, implementing safety protocols and monitoring adherence to safety standards to prevent accidents and promote a secure working environment.
  • Responsible for the submission of accurate site records to enable effective monitoring of programme and cost plans as requested to agreed format as applicable.
  • Prepare, develop, and maintain project documentation, ensuring proper organization, accessibility and accuracy for future reference and audits.
  • Ensure that toolbox talks, task briefs, permits and COSS briefs are carried out for all work tasks prior to commencement of work for allocated contracts.
  • Ensure that all allocated tasks are undertaken in accordance with the planned safe method of working.
  • Responsible for ordering and receipt of site deliverables, timely returns of goods receipts notices
  • Responsible for ordering and receipt of site plant, including security and timely off–hire.
  • Coordinating the various professionals involved in the project, subcontractors and suppliers. Assigning tasks, monitoring progress and ensuring quality workmanship fall under your purview.
  • Monitor and supervise sub-contractors, contract staff and direct labour for allocated site activities.
  • Carry out performance reviews for direct reports, administering poor performance, attendance management and disciplinary procedures as applicable.
  • The role is one that includes site supervision and based generally in a site environment. It is a requirement of the role to attend site on a regular basis (including nighttime and weekends).
